如何使用ThinkPHP6实现CRM管理系统

随着企业的发展,客户数量逐渐增加,管理客户信息变得越来越重要。为了解决这一问题,很多企业选择了使用CRM(客户关系管理系统)来管理客户信息。而现在,使用PHP框架ThinkPHP6来实现一个高效的CRM管理系统也成为了一种不错的选择。本文将介绍如何使用ThinkPHP6来实现CRM管理系统。

  • 环境搭建
  • 首先,需要安装和配置好PHP环境、MySQL数据库,并下载安装好ThinkPHP6框架。

  • 创建数据库和数据表
  • 使用MySQL Workbench或其他工具创建一个名为“crm”的数据库,并创建以下数据表:

    • 用户表(user):包含用户ID、用户名、密码、邮箱、电话等字段。
    • 客户表(customer):包含客户ID、客户名称、联系人、联系人电话、备注等字段。
    • 联系人表(contact):包含联系人ID、联系人姓名、所属客户、性别、生日等字段。
    • 交易记录表(deal):包含交易记录ID、所属客户、交易类型、交易时间、交易金额等字段。
  • 配置数据库连接
  • 在ThinkPHP6框架的config/database.php文件中,使用以下代码配置MySQL数据库连接: